I've was asked to make some birthday tags for a Mom who has school-going kiddies.
There are about 10 and more birthdays that these children get invited to and
she needed some little tags to adhere to the gifts, so I made her some of these.

Just a close up. They are so easy to make. The internet is full of lovely
free images to print and if you have scalloped dies or any other shaped die, you
can churn these out in no time.  I punched a hole and used an eyelet to thread the
cord through.
